What Real Dum Biryani Actually Is

The word “dum” is Persian for “breath” or “slow steam.” Dum biryani is not a variety of rice dish. It is a method. The pot is sealed. The steam cannot escape. What circulates inside that sealed vessel is what makes biryani biryani and not a rice pilaf.

Most people who have eaten a disappointing biryani in the Netherlands have eaten rice that was cooked separately and mixed with a curry sauce at the end. That is not biryani. That is rice and curry served together in one bowl, presented to look like the real thing. The grains are not layered. The steam has not done its work. The saffron, if used at all, is distributed so evenly it might as well be food colouring.

The marinated halal protein - chicken or lamb - is layered in the pot with partially cooked saffron basmati, freshly ground spices, and fried onions. The pot is sealed and the dish finishes on low heat, entirely on steam. The saffron sits in threads, not uniformly blended, so when the lid comes off at the table you get pockets of fragrance.

The result is visible when the lid is lifted at the table. Some grains are golden from the saffron. Others are white. Others are stained by the freshly ground spices. That variation is the proof of the method. Uniform rice is the proof that someone cut corners.

How Chopras Indian Restaurant Makes Biryani in Den Haag

It starts every morning before service. The kitchen at Chopras Indian Restaurant grinds its masalas from whole spices imported directly from India. Cumin, cardamom, coriander seed, cloves, black pepper, cinnamon sticks, bay leaves. The volatile aromatic oils in freshly ground spices begin to evaporate within hours of grinding. A pre-mixed blend sitting in a warehouse for weeks cannot compete. This is the difference you taste in every dish across the full Chopras Indian Restaurant menu.

The chicken is marinated overnight in a yoghurt base with fresh ginger and garlic. The lamb, shoulder cut for the lamb biryani, is treated the same way. Both are sourced from fully halal-certified suppliers. Every evening, without exception. By the time the protein reaches the pot, it has already absorbed a layer of flavour from within the flesh itself.

The basmati rice is soaked and partially cooked, intentionally left short of done, because it will finish inside the sealed pot. Real saffron threads are steeped in warm water and drizzled across the top layer of rice before the pot is sealed. The lid goes on the heat. The steam does the rest.
